The Enchanting Appeal of Kirkjufell

Kirkjufell’s distinct shape, resembling a church steeple or a wizard’s hat, depending on your imagination, makes it one of Iceland’s most photographed landmarks. This 463-meter high mountain is not just a marvel to look at; it’s a symbol of Iceland’s raw and unspoiled beauty. The mountain’s green slopes in summer, snowy white cloak in winter, and the Northern Lights dancing above in the right conditions, create a picture-perfect scene.

How to Get There: Navigating to Kirkjufell

Reaching Kirkjufell is straightforward and part of the adventure. Located near the town of Grundarfjörður, it’s about a two-and-a-half-hour drive from Reykjavik via road 1 and heading north.

Best Time to Visit

Each season offers a unique perspective of Kirkjufell. Summer brings vibrant greenery and longer daylight hours, ideal for hiking in the surrounding and photography of midnight sun. Winter, on the other hand, offers a chance to see the Northern Lights, with the mountain providing a stunning backdrop.

Spring and autumn also have their charm, with fewer tourists and beautiful transitional colors in the landscape.

Activities Around Kirkjufell

  • Hiking: There are hiking trails around Kirkjufell, suitable for various skill levels. The hike to the top can be challenging, so it’s recommended for experienced hikers. However, there are easier trails at the base, offering stunning views and photo opportunities.
  • Photography: Kirkjufell is a dream location for photographers. The best spot to capture the mountain is from Kirkjufellsfoss waterfall, where you can frame the mountain with the waterfall in the foreground. The site is just a short walk from the main road.
  • Bird Watching: The area around Kirkjufell is rich in birdlife, making it a great spot for bird watching. Keep an eye out for different species, especially during the migratory seasons.
  • Northern Lights Viewing: If you visit in the winter, don’t miss the chance to witness the Northern Lights. The area around Kirkjufell, with its dark skies, is ideal for observing this natural phenomenon.

Accommodations and Facilities

Grundarfjörður, the nearest town, offers a range of accommodations, from cozy guesthouses to comfortable hotels. There are also restaurants and cafes where you can taste local Icelandic cuisine. Remember, it’s always best to book your stay in advance, especially during peak tourist seasons.

Tips for a Memorable Visit

  1. Respect Nature: Iceland’s landscapes are precious. Stick to marked trails and avoid disturbing the natural environment.
  2. Prepare for the Weather: The weather in Iceland can be unpredictable. Dress in layers and bring waterproof gear, even in summer.
  3. Safety First: If you plan to hike, inform someone about your plans and check the weather forecast. Safety should always be your priority.
  4. Capture Memories: Bring a camera to capture the stunning scenery, but also take time to soak in the beauty with your eyes.
  5. Explore Nearby Attractions: The Snæfellsnes peninsula is home to many other attractions, like the Snæfellsjökull glacier and the charming village of Stykkishólmur. Make time to explore these gems as well.
